HTML5 Games: A Natural Fit for Modern Gamers

Rather than relying on third-party downloads or system updates, HTML5 enables seamless in-browser engagement. The result is something developers refer to as "progressive immersion"—gamers pick up a title without friction, explore environments dynamically across multiple platforms, and invest real attention before considering deeper interactions, like micro-purchases or level persistence mechanisms.

  • Cross-device fluidity enhances replay value
  • No app store dependencies equals faster global adoption
  • Dedicated UI adaptation tools reduce localization overhead
Trait HTML5 Advantage Flash Equivalent Weaknes
Mobile Responsiveness Optimized via CSS scaling Unreliable multi-screen support pre-Adobe phase-out
Mechanic Complexity Supports real-time physics engines in browsers Heavy processing burden caused performance hiccups

Chef’s Secret Recipe: Mixing Core Adventure Elements Without Bloating File Size

Adventure Component

Mechanism Layer Data Optimization Strategy
Dialogue branching tree (>10 options deep) Use Web Worker thread + lazy-load localized JSON packets instead of inline code dumps
Faction relationship progression map Leverage localStorage APIs instead heavy database pings per scene update

(Table: Real-world techniques employed to preserve interactivity depth while avoiding bloat common in mobile ports)

Navigational Structures: How Map Interfaces Influence Engagement Rates

We've seen consistent conversion lifts whenever maps function simultaneously both navigation systems *and gameplay zones*. Example—certain Bulgaria-focused multiplayer adventures integrated territorial conflict mechanics right within the world overview itself; users effectively “capture land" by completing adjacent quests sequentially. This transforms the typical minimap overlay into a tangible game element worth competing over—not just a compass aid but active stakes in play progression.
